-
-
Notifications
You must be signed in to change notification settings - Fork 2.9k
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We鈥檒l occasionally send you account related emails.
Already on GitHub? Sign in to your account
Auto update failing for taskwarrior #19568
Comments
I'd love to see this package updated, as it's been several days since version 3.0.0 was released. Would it be possible for the maintainers to look into this issue? |
I got the following error while compiling taskwarrior version 3.0.0.
|
Can't even get that far, I'm getting:
|
I have modified the build.sh for the new rust additions in taskwarrior project. Click here to see the diffdiff --git a/packages/taskwarrior/build.sh b/packages/taskwarrior/build.sh
index 1db6ceb..3751358 100644
--- a/packages/taskwarrior/build.sh
+++ b/packages/taskwarrior/build.sh
@@ -2,16 +2,19 @@ TERMUX_PKG_HOMEPAGE=https://taskwarrior.org
TERMUX_PKG_DESCRIPTION="Utility for managing your TODO list"
TERMUX_PKG_LICENSE="MIT"
TERMUX_PKG_MAINTAINER="@termux"
-TERMUX_PKG_VERSION=2.6.2
-TERMUX_PKG_REVISION=3
+TERMUX_PKG_VERSION="3.0.0"
TERMUX_PKG_SRCURL=https://github.com/GothenburgBitFactory/taskwarrior/releases/download/v${TERMUX_PKG_VERSION}/task-${TERMUX_PKG_VERSION}.tar.gz
-TERMUX_PKG_SHA256=b1d3a7f000cd0fd60640670064e0e001613c9e1cb2242b9b3a9066c78862cfec
+TERMUX_PKG_SHA256=30f397081044f5dc2e5a0ba51609223011a23281cd9947ea718df98d149fcc83
TERMUX_PKG_AUTO_UPDATE=true
TERMUX_PKG_DEPENDS="libc++, libgnutls, libuuid, libandroid-glob"
TERMUX_CMAKE_BUILD="Unix Makefiles"
termux_step_pre_configure() {
+ termux_setup_rust
LDFLAGS+=" -landroid-glob"
+
+ # Remove this workaround after https://github.com/GothenburgBitFactory/taskwarrior/issues/3294 is fixed
+ sed -i '/integration-tests/d' "$TERMUX_PKG_SRCDIR"/Cargo.toml
}
termux_step_post_make_install() { |
Ah great. Do you mind if I take this one, or do you want to send in a PR? |
Yeah, sure. Please feel free to copy or modify that patch or anything I do or say ;) It does not work though as mentioned above. |
Yeah I'm now getting an error related to `ninja`
|
CMake should not use Ninja as |
Derp, yep I had that commented out because I wanted to know if its still needed. |
Yep, getting that one now. |
Hi, I'm Termux 馃.
I'm here to help you update your Termux packages.
I've tried to update the taskwarrior package, but it failed.
Here's the output of the update script:
Show log
Above error occured when I last tried to update at 2024-03-25 00:27:01 UTC.
Run ID: 8413166754
Note: Automatic updates will be disabled until this issue is resolved.
The text was updated successfully, but these errors were encountered: